    FC (Fibre Channel) zoning is a method used in Storage Area Networks (SANs) to control and restrict access between devices. It ensures that only authorized devices can communicate with each other, improving security, reducing traffic congestion, and enhancing performance. Switch stacking is a feature of certain Cisco access layer switches which allows for the creation of a single logical device from many individual devices via a backside stack port connected by several stack cables.

    The Visual Fault Locator (VFL) Pen has a visible red light source centered on 650nm. A fiber visual fault locator pen VFL for fiber optic installation, fault finding, continuity checking, polarity checking, verifying a signal path, and identifying a fiber.     This device is a small transceiver you plug into a switch, router, or server. The main job of an SFP optic module is to change electrical signals into optical signals for fiber cables. SFP (Small Form-factor Pluggable) is a compact, hot-pluggable network interface module used to connect network devices (switches, routers, firewalls) to fiber optic or copper cables. An SFP interface on networking hardware is a modular slot for a media-specific transceiver, such as for a fiber-optic cable or a copper.
